You will not be allowed to pack all of your garden items

Moving companies will not allow you to transport some of the items you own. These items are, for example, perishable food, ammunition, and gasoline. However, there are also some items that can be found in your garage or tool shed which are also on this list. Those are fertilizers, acids, paints, poisons, etc. Therefore, it is advisable to ask your moving company about this instance. They are the ones who should provide you with a complete list of items they are not going to transport. By doing this, you will know exactly what you can and cannot pack. Also, do not try to fool them- the primary reason why they have this rule is your safety and safety of your belongings.

When you pack garden items, make sure you pick the right boxes

For packing hand tools, you should use small moving boxes. The reason for choosing the right type of a moving box is to ensure that the boxes do not break or are too heavy to lift. You can use your toolbox to pack the smaller tools, such as hammers, screwdrivers, wrenches, and pliers. If it happens that there are some empty spaces in the toolbox, just put some packing paper there. By doing this, you will prevent your tools from moving around. In case you still have the containers your power tools came in, pack those tools inside of them. After that, put the containers in a small moving box. If there are some tools that no longer have the original container, just wrap up the sharp and pointy parts. You can do this by using towels, bubble wrap, and tape.

How to pack other tools and supplies

You should pay special attention to how you are packing garden items. Not just because they can break but also because you or somebody else can hurt yourselves. Therefore, when it comes to tools with sharp parts like garden shears or hedge trimmers, make sure you use some bubble wrap. They should be properly wrapped up before you pack them into small moving boxes. You should also do this to flower pots and ceramic planters. They can easily break and this is the only way in which you can prevent this scenario from happening. When it comes to larger garden tools like shovels, rakes and brooms, you should first bundle them together. You can use tape or rope for this- after that, wrap them up in a moving blanket. What to do with some larger garden items

In case you own large items, such as lawnmowers and other fuel-powered tools, you should pay special attention to them. This means that you should empty them of all liquids before the transport. As you already know, fuel cannot be transported, even if it is inside a machine. Also, when it comes to the spark plugs, you should wrap them with lots of cardboard. By doing this, you will secure them and prevent them from breaking or damaging other items. If you have a grill, you should dispose of any charcoal and hose. You will get rid of any grease and soot and the grill will be ready to use when you move into your new home. You will be able to make some barbecue on the moving day if you have enough time.
